Key Facts
- True Love's instance of is recorded as single[3].
- True Love's genre is dance-pop[4].
- True Love's genre is electronic rock[5].
- True Love followed Just Give Me a Reason[6].
- True Love followed 5 O'Clock[7].
- True Love was followed by Walk of Shame[8].
- True Love was followed by Somewhere Only We Know[9].
- True Love was produced by Greg Kurstin[10].
- Among the performers on True Love was Pink[11].
- Among the performers on True Love was Lily Allen[12].
- True Love's record label is recorded as RCA Records[13].
- True Love is part of The Truth About Love[14].
- True Love was distributed by music download[15].
- True Love's country of origin is recorded as United States[16].
- 2012 marks the founding of True Love[17].
- True Love was published on June 28, 2013[18].
- True Love's lyricist is recorded as Pink[19].
